About the Atlas Sound FA97-6 Recessed Speaker Enclosure

The FA97-6 is a specialized recessed speaker enclosure engineered for professional audio installations requiring a clean, architecturally integrated appearance. It serves as a drop-in, pre-constructed housing designed to be installed within standard wall and ceiling cavities, providing a rigid and acoustically optimized environment for component loudspeakers. The enclosure's primary function is to transform an open stud bay or joist space into a properly sealed and braised loudspeaker cabinet, which is essential for achieving accurate bass response and preventing acoustic phase cancellation that occurs when a speaker driver is mounted in an infinite, untreated open space. Constructed from dense, laminated medium-density fibreboard, the box provides the necessary acoustic damping and structural integrity to support the dynamic forces generated by the speaker, ensuring clean, tight sound reproduction.

Installation is streamlined for efficiency on construction sites, featuring a versatile design with flanged edges that allow for secure mounting directly to wooden or metal framing studs prior to the application of drywall. The enclosure includes integrated brackets and adjustable dog-leg clamps that provide a firm grip on the drywall from behind, ensuring a stable, rattle-free installation once the wall surface is complete. Key cutouts and knockouts are strategically placed to accommodate various speaker sizes and wiring methods, including conduit entries, allowing for a clean and professional finish. The interior is finished with acoustical foam or damping material to absorb internal reflections and reduce standing waves, further refining the speaker's output by minimizing unwanted cabinet resonance.
